Cody (COD) to Denver (DEN)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Yellowstone Regional Airport (COD) in Cody, United States to Denver International Airport (DEN) in Denver, United States is 630 kilometers (391 miles / 340 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ying southeast at a heading of 144°.

This is a short-haul route typically served by narrow-body aircraft such as the Boeing 737 or Airbus A320 family. In-flight service is usually limited to drinks and light snacks.

This is a domestic route within United States. Both airports operate in the same country, which may simplify travel requirements and documentation.

Time zone information: When it's 10:38 in Cody, it's 10:38 in Denver.

The return flight from Denver (DEN) to Cody (COD) follows a heading of 327° (north northw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
